Understanding Harrisburg's Winter Driving Conditions



Harrisburg sits in a transitional climate area where winter months weather can move significantly within hours. The Susquehanna River Valley channels cold air and wetness, developing microclimates that can surprise even knowledgeable local motorists. One area could have clear roads while another deals with black ice. These conditions place extraordinary demands on your lorry's quiting power and grip.

Temperature fluctuations between cold and thawing develop specifically unsafe roadway surfaces. Water permeates into sidewalk fractures during warmer moments, then increases when temperature levels drop over night. This freeze-thaw cycle problems roadway surfaces and develops uneven surface that challenges both tire grasp and brake response. Vehicle proprietors who comprehend these regional patterns can time their upkeep to make the most of security and performance.



When to Schedule Your Brake Inspection



Smart vehicle drivers in Central Pennsylvania begin thinking about brake solution before the initial frost arrives. Late September with very early October represents the ideal home window for extensive brake assessment. This timing enables specialists to identify used elements prior to wintertime weather condition compounds any kind of current issues.

Brake pads normally wear down with usage, but cold temperatures can increase degeneration of already-compromised components. A pad that could last one more month in modest weather might fail hazardously when based on icy conditions and regular tough stops. Specialist evaluation discloses real problem of your entire brake system, including blades, calipers, brake lines, and liquid levels.

The relationship between brake liquid and winter performance is worthy of unique attention. Brake liquid absorbs dampness with time, which lowers its boiling point and can lead to decreased performance. In freezing temperature levels, contaminated brake liquid comes to be much more bothersome. Fresh fluid guarantees consistent pedal feeling and quiting power despite outside temperature level.



Acknowledging Signs Your Brakes Need Attention



Your automobile interacts its requirements through different signals that become especially crucial as winter season methods. Screeching or grinding noises suggest worn brake pads that have actually reached or surpassed their service life. These sounds may begin faintly yet grow louder as damages proceeds. Resolving these warnings early protects against much more pricey fixings in the future.

Resonance through the brake pedal or steering wheel during quits suggests blades issues. Deformed blades fail to provide smooth, also contact with brake pads, lowering quiting efficiency. This problem becomes dangerous on slippery winter months roads where you require all available stopping power. A soft or squishy brake pedal indicates air in the brake lines or low liquid levels. This problem calls for immediate specialist interest no matter season, yet ends up being specifically essential before winter season weather condition shows up. Similarly, if your vehicle pulls to one side throughout braking, you likely have irregular pad wear or a stuck caliper that needs solution.



The Critical Importance of Winter Tires



Several Harrisburg location drivers underestimate exactly how considerably tire choice impacts winter security. All-season tires stand for a compromise that works properly in moderate conditions yet disappoints winter season tire performance when roadways transform treacherous. The rubber compounds in wintertime tires stay flexible at temperatures listed below 45 levels Fahrenheit, keeping hold when all-season tires stiffen and shed grip.

Winter tire walk patterns include deeper grooves and even more biting edges developed especially to carry snow and slush away from the get in touch with patch. These aggressive patterns go into snow cover and preserve contact with the roadway surface area below. The performance difference becomes promptly noticeable during the initial considerable snowfall of the period.

The uneven surface bordering Harrisburg makes winter tires especially useful. Climbing up snow-covered qualities or coming down icy inclines safely requires maximum traction. Winter months tires offer confidence that all-season choices merely can not match in these tough situations. Ideal Timing for Tire Changes



Installing wintertime tires prior to you require them rates among the most intelligent choices any type of Harrisburg chauffeur can make. Waiting until after the very first snowfall implies taking on everybody else for solution visits throughout a rush duration. Service technicians get bewildered, and you might find yourself driving on insufficient tires while waiting days for an available time port.

The general guideline recommends switching to winter months tires once daytime temperature levels consistently remain listed below 45 degrees. For Central Pennsylvania, this typically happens in mid to late November. However, starting your search and acquisition process in October offers you versatility to pick quality tires without time stress. You can schedule installment throughout a practical weekday appointment instead of rushing throughout an emergency situation.

Appropriate tire storage space matters equally as much as timely setup. If you keep your off-season tires in the house, save them in an awesome, dry place away from direct sunlight. Ozone from electric motors and temperature extremes accelerate rubber deterioration. Numerous service facilities provide seasonal tire storage, eliminating this concern while liberating space in your garage.



Checking Tire Condition and Pressure



Also the best winter tires lose effectiveness as they wear down. Tread deepness straight associates with snow grip and water emptying ability. The penny examination gives a quick assessment: insert a cent into the step with Lincoln's head inverted. If you can see the top of his head, your tires require replacement before winter months shows up.

Cold weather creates tire pressure to go down around one pound per square inch for every single 10-degree temperature decline. A tire correctly inflated throughout summer most likely runs numerous pounds low once winter season settles in. Under-inflated tires decrease fuel economic climate, use unevenly, and manage inadequately in emergency situations. Checking pressure regular monthly throughout winter stops these troubles.

The shutoff stems and tire sidewalls also should have inspection before wintertime. Fractured rubber or harmed stems can leakage air gradually, creating persistent pressure problems. Replace jeopardized elements proactively instead of managing punctures throughout snow storms. This straightforward preventative step conserves substantial disappointment throughout the winter season.

Beyond Tires and Brakes: Supporting Systems



While tires and brakes take priority for winter season preparation, numerous support group enhance their performance. Battery performance decreases in cold weather, possibly leaving you stranded in car park after work. Evaluating battery charge capacity and cleansing wore away terminals protects against these discouraging situations. A battery that struggles on moderate autumn early mornings will likely stop working during the very first hard freeze.

Wiper blades and washing machine fluid may appear small compared to brakes and tires, however they straight affect visibility and safety and security. Winter wiper blades stand up to ice buildup better than basic variations, keeping clear windscreens during snow and sleet. Making use of washing machine fluid rated for subzero temperature levels prevents frozen storage tanks and guarantees you can clean salt spray and road gunk whenever essential.

Your vehicle's illumination system comes to be more important as winter season brings shorter days and minimized presence. Snow, haze, and very early darkness mean fronts lights see hefty usage throughout the period. Dim or misaligned lights reduce your ability to see dangers and make your automobile much less noticeable to others. Changing shed bulbs and changing goal takes very little time yet dramatically boosts safety and security.
